Exchange Exemplar: Hiring Microbes To Defeat Other Microbes

sbtlneet/Pixabay

We've all gotten a crash course in the pandemic about viruses and how they can kill us, and how they can be defeated by vaccines.

It turns out viruses can also help us in certain situations... for example, in defeating bacteria that antibiotics have no effect against.

It's combat at a microscope level, a story told by epidemiologist Steffanie Strathdee in The Perfect Predator: A Scientist's Race to Save Her Husband from a Deadly Superbug.

Yes, the husband is Steffanie's, and it took bacteriophages to save him. Hear how in this interview from 2019.
